保护OpenStack组件和数据对于确保系统的安全和稳定性非常重要。以下是一些保护OpenStack组件和数据的方法: 访问控制:使用身份验证和授权机制来限制用户对OpenStack组件和数据的访问权限。确保只有经过授权的用户可以访问系统,并...
OpenStack的升级和迁移是一个复杂的过程,需要谨慎规划和执行。以下是一些常见的步骤和注意事项: 升级OpenStack版本: 确保备份所有重要数据和配置文件。 检查当前OpenStack环境的硬件和软件要求,以确保新版本的兼容性。 下载并...
在OpenStack中,资源限制和优化可以通过以下方式实现: 使用配额管理:OpenStack允许管理员为每个项目设置资源配额,包括CPU、内存、存储等资源。通过限制每个项目可以使用的资源量,可以有效地控制资源的使用。 使用资源调度器:...
OpenStack是一个开源的云计算平台,而Docker是一个开源的容器化平台,它们可以相互集成以提供更强大的云计算和容器化功能。以下是一些方法来集成OpenStack和Docker: 使用OpenStack Magnum:OpenStack Magnum是一个项目,专门为容器...
OpenStack和Kubernetes可以集成以实现更灵活的云计算解决方案。以下是一些集成方法: 使用Kubernetes作为OpenStack的容器编排引擎:可以在OpenStack云环境中部署Kubernetes集群,以便更好地管理容器化的应用程序。 使用OpenStack...
OpenStack的Neutron是一个网络服务项目,它为OpenStack提供了网络连接。Neutron允许用户创建和管理虚拟网络,包括子网、路由、安全组等,并为虚拟机提供网络连接。Neutron还支持多种网络插件,可以与各种不同类型的网络设备和技术集成...
在OpenStack中,可以通过以下几种方式来实现多租户架构: 通过Keystone进行身份认证和授权:OpenStack的身份认证和授权服务Keystone可以帮助实现多租户架构。Keystone可以管理不同租户的用户和角色,并为不同租户分配不同的权限,以...
OpenStack可以通过多种方式实现水平扩展服务,以下是一些有效的方法: 使用负载均衡器:OpenStack提供了负载均衡服务,如OpenStack Octavia,可以将流量分布到多个相同的服务实例上,从而实现水平扩展。负载均衡器可以根据流量情况...
OpenStack中的Nova是一个用于管理和部署虚拟机实例的计算服务组件。它提供了虚拟机实例的创建、启动、暂停、恢复和删除等功能,同时还支持对实例进行资源调度、监控和管理。Nova通过与其他OpenStack组件的集成,如Neutron网络服务和Ci...
OpenStack使用Keystone作为身份认证和访问控制服务来管理访问权限。通过Keystone,可以创建用户、角色和项目,并为这些用户分配适当的角色和权限。用户可以通过用户名和密码或者token来认证,然后根据其角色和项目来决定其可以访问的...
OpenStack架构中的网络功能虚拟化是通过Neutron服务来实现的。Neutron是OpenStack的网络服务,它提供了网络虚拟化和管理功能,允许用户创建和管理虚拟网络,子网,路由和防火墙等网络功能。 网络功能虚拟化是通过将网络功能从物理设备...
OpenStack的Glance是一个用于管理虚拟机镜像的服务,它在云环境中起到了重要作用。具体来说,Glance提供了以下功能和作用: 镜像存储:Glance可以存储各种不同的虚拟机镜像,包括操作系统镜像、应用程序镜像等。这些镜像可以被用来...
在Oracle中,LENGTHB函数用于返回一个字符串的字节数。它可以用来计算一个字符串的字节数,而不是字符数。这在处理二进制数据或者包含多字节字符的字符串时非常有用。 例如,如果我们有一个包含中文字符的字符串,我们可以使用LENGTHB...
要导出一个.mdf文件,你可以使用SQL Server Management Studio(SSMS)中的“Generate Scripts”功能来生成SQL脚本,然后执行该脚本来创建一个新的数据库并将数据导入其中。 以下是使用SSMS导出.mdf文件的步骤: 打开SQL Server Manage...
在Oracle数据库中执行SQL文件可以通过以下几种方式: 使用SQL*Plus命令行工具:在命令行中输入以下命令可以执行SQL文件: sqlplus username/password@database @path/to/sqlfile.sql 其中,username是数据库用户名,password是密码...
在SQL Server中保存数据库,可以通过以下步骤操作: 打开SQL Server Management Studio(SSMS)。 连接到SQL Server数据库引擎。 在对象资源管理器中,选择要保存的数据库。 右键单击该数据库,选择“任务” > “生成脚本”。 ...
在Oracle数据库中,LENGTHB函数用于返回指定字符串的字节数。这可以很有用,特别是当处理双字节字符集(如UTF-8)时。LENGTHB函数返回字符串中的字节数,而不是字符数。这在某些情况下是很有用的,例如当需要计算字符串在存储空间中所...
在PL/SQL中执行SQL脚本文件可以通过使用SQL*Plus或者SQL Developer工具来实现。 使用SQL*Plus执行SQL脚本文件: 打开命令行窗口,输入以下命令: sqlplus username/password@database @script_file_path 其中,username是数据库用...
在PL/SQL中打开SQL脚本有多种方法,以下是其中几种常用的方法: 使用SQLPlus命令行界面:可以在SQLPlus中使用@命令来打开并执行SQL脚本,例如: SQL> @path/to/your/script.sql 使用PL/SQL Developer工具:在PL/SQL Developer...
当Oracle数据文件损坏时,可以尝试以下方法来解决问题: 使用RMAN(Recovery Manager)工具来尝试修复损坏的数据文件。RMAN是Oracle数据库的备份和恢复工具,可以帮助恢复损坏的数据文件。 如果RMAN无法修复数据文件,则可以尝试...